<h4>Objective</h4> Phenotypic diversity of autoimmune diseases presents an ongoing diagnostic and drug development challenge for clinicians and scientists. Recent discovery of mutations in RELA (encoding RELA) in patients with different diagnoses has highlighted that different pathogenic molecular mechanisms are at play and may explain the observed phenotypic diversity.
